TICKIT_WIN...OR_POSITION(3) Library Functions Manual TICKIT_WIN...OR_POSITION(3) NAME tickit_window_set_cursor_position, tickit_window_set_cursor_visible, tickit_window_set_cursor_shape - modify the cursor state on a window SYNOPSIS #include <tickit.h> void tickit_window_set_cursor_position(TickitWindow *win, int line, int col); void tickit_window_set_cursor_visible(TickitWindow *win, bool visible); void tickit_window_set_cursor_shape(TickitWindow *win, TickitCursorShape shape); Link with -ltickit. DESCRIPTION tickit_window_set_cursor_position() sets the position within the given win- dow where the terminal cursor would be displayed, if the window has the fo- cus. tickit_window_set_cursor_visible() sets whether the terminal cursor is vis- ible when the given window has the focus. tickit_window_set_cursor_shape() sets what shape the terminal cursor will have if the given window has the focus. Note that none of these functions actually affect the input focus directly, they simply set what the state of the cursor will be if the given window has the input focus. To set the input focus, see tickit_window_take_fo- cus(3). RETURN VALUE These functions all return no value.
